Abstract
The utility model provides a kind of power line with sheath, including sheath, and the multiple conductors being located in sheath, it is sequentially provided with cold-resistant layer from outside to inside inside sheath, external insulation layer, screen layer, described screen layer is formed by tinned copper wire braiding, described external insulation layer uses Ceramic silicon rubber to extrude formation, it is filled with single between described screen layer and conductor, region between adjacent two conductors is provided with tears rubber-insulated wire, described conductor includes that layers of copper is coated on outside steel core, it is wound with the banding reinforcement of insulation in layers of copper outer felt, it is coated with inner insulating layer outside the banding reinforcement of insulation.The beneficial effects of the utility model are: the cold-resistant layer of setting, insulating barrier, improve its cold resistance and play fire prevention, the effect of insulation;Conductor uses layers of copper to be coated on steel core, has saved the consumption of copper, improves the tensile property of power line.

Detailed description of the invention
As Figure 1-3, the technical solution of the utility model is: a kind of power line with sheath, including sheath 1 and
The multiple conductors being located in sheath 1, are sequentially provided with cold-resistant layer the 2nd, external insulation layer the 3rd, screen layer 4, institute inside sheath 1 from outside to inside
The screen layer 4 stated is formed by tinned copper wire braiding, and described external insulation layer 3 uses Ceramic silicon rubber to extrude formation, Neng Gouyou
Effect prevents artificial destruction from destroying, and under Fires Occurred, its insulating barrier 3 can burn till hard ceramic-like, is coated with closely
At conductive surface, serve fire prevention and the effect of insulation, farthest reduce loss, described screen layer 4 and conductor it
Between be filled with single 5, the region between adjacent two conductors is provided with tears rubber-insulated wire 6, tears rubber-insulated wire 6 owing to being provided with, and only need to pull and tear
Line skin can quickly be cut open by rubber-insulated wire 6, easy to operate, completely the instrument without specialty, it is to avoid hinders hand and scratches core etc. now
As occurring, more effectively protecting the serviceability of personal safety and electric wire, bringing convenience to use, construction, described leads
Body includes that layers of copper 7 is coated on outside steel core 8, is wound with the banding reinforcement 9 of insulation in layers of copper 7 outer felt, and the banding in insulation is strengthened
Being coated with inner insulating layer 10 outside part 9, conductor uses layers of copper 7 to be coated on steel core 8, adds the bulk strength of power line, and
Save the consumption of copper, reduce cost, energy-saving safe.
It in the present embodiment, in described sheath 1, is provided with 3 conductors.
In the present embodiment, described cold-resistant layer 2 is ethylene-propylene-diene monomer glue-line, has preferable cold resistance, at subzero 40 DEG C
Puna under remain to keep good elasticity, wearability and bending property.
In the present embodiment, described sheath 1 outer surface is provided with anti-slip veins 11.
